Quote:

Originally Posted by Badhobz (Post 8978230)
Yeah I’ll need cell reception so I guess those Forest service roads are out eh ?

I got a vw sportwagon with 4motion so nothing too crazy is preferable

West harrison forest service road up to about 20-25 km has reasonable cell reception.

Was getting LTE in some spots.

I'd head out that way. Lots of spots here and there and the road appeared freshly graded when I went in about 4 weeks ago.

Didnt hit any snow.

Take bear spray and leave a trip plan with someone.
